The site relies on several industry cliches such as curated collection, meticulously vetted, and luxury of a hotel. Despite this, the value proposition is relatively unique compared to generic booking sites, as it explicitly positions itself as the Michelin star for rentals. Template language is minimal, as the comparison pages (vs Airbnb) and host pages contain specific pricing and protocol details that would be difficult to copy-paste onto a competitor site.
